Output 2bf4fc647268591d7038511e6902406d4ae662a06591a03224c505146631558d:2

value
632172
script pubkey
OP_0 OP_PUSHBYTES_20 948093dab96d8277632f566e8d25e4a2e0250b17
address
tb1qjjqf8k4edkp8wce02ehg6f0y5tsz2zchn34xgx
transaction
2bf4fc647268591d7038511e6902406d4ae662a06591a03224c505146631558d
confirmations
82775
spent
true